4 depends on SND!=n && PCI
11 tristate "ALi M5451 PCI Audio Controller"
13 select SND_MPU401_UART
16 Say Y here to include support for the integrated AC97 sound
17 device on motherboards using the ALi M5451 Audio Controller
18 (M1535/M1535D/M1535+/M1535D+ south bridges). Newer chipsets
19 use the "Intel/SiS/nVidia/AMD/ALi AC97 Controller" driver.
21 To compile this driver as a module, choose M here: the module
22 will be called snd-ali5451.
25 tristate "ATI IXP AC97 Controller"
29 Say Y here to include support for the integrated AC97 sound
30 device on motherboards with ATI chipsets (ATI IXP 150/200/250/
33 To compile this driver as a module, choose M here: the module
34 will be called snd-atiixp.
36 config SND_ATIIXP_MODEM
37 tristate "ATI IXP Modem"
41 Say Y here to include support for the integrated MC97 modem on
42 motherboards with ATI chipsets (ATI IXP 150/200/250).
44 To compile this driver as a module, choose M here: the module
45 will be called snd-atiixp-modem.
48 tristate "Aureal Advantage"
50 select SND_MPU401_UART
53 Say Y here to include support for Aureal Advantage soundcards.
55 Supported features: Hardware Mixer, SRC, EQ and SPDIF output.
56 3D support code is in place, but not yet useable. For more info,
57 email the ALSA developer list, or <mjander@users.sourceforge.net>.
59 To compile this driver as a module, choose M here: the module
60 will be called snd-au8810.
63 tristate "Aureal Vortex"
65 select SND_MPU401_UART
68 Say Y here to include support for Aureal Vortex soundcards.
70 Supported features: Hardware Mixer and SRC. For more info, email
71 the ALSA developer list, or <mjander@users.sourceforge.net>.
73 To compile this driver as a module, choose M here: the module
74 will be called snd-au8820.
77 tristate "Aureal Vortex 2"
79 select SND_MPU401_UART
82 Say Y here to include support for Aureal Vortex 2 soundcards.
84 Supported features: Hardware Mixer, SRC, EQ and SPDIF output.
85 3D support code is in place, but not yet useable. For more info,
86 email the ALSA developer list, or <mjander@users.sourceforge.net>.
88 To compile this driver as a module, choose M here: the module
89 will be called snd-au8830.
92 tristate "Aztech AZF3328 / PCI168 (EXPERIMENTAL)"
93 depends on SND && EXPERIMENTAL
95 select SND_MPU401_UART
98 Say Y here to include support for Aztech AZF3328 (PCI168)
101 To compile this driver as a module, choose M here: the module
102 will be called snd-azt3328.
105 tristate "Bt87x Audio Capture"
109 If you want to record audio from TV cards based on
110 Brooktree Bt878/Bt879 chips, say Y here and read
111 <file:Documentation/sound/alsa/Bt87x.txt>.
113 To compile this driver as a module, choose M here: the module
114 will be called snd-bt87x.
116 config SND_BT87X_OVERCLOCK
117 bool "Bt87x Audio overclocking"
120 Say Y here if 448000 Hz isn't enough for you and you want to
121 record from the analog input with up to 1792000 Hz.
123 Higher sample rates won't hurt your hardware, but audio
127 tristate "Cirrus Logic (Sound Fusion) CS4280/CS461x/CS462x/CS463x"
130 select SND_AC97_CODEC
132 Say Y here to include support for Cirrus Logic CS4610/CS4612/
133 CS4614/CS4615/CS4622/CS4624/CS4630/CS4280 chips.
135 To compile this driver as a module, choose M here: the module
136 will be called snd-cs46xx.
138 config SND_CS46XX_NEW_DSP
139 bool "Cirrus Logic (Sound Fusion) New DSP support (EXPERIMENTAL)"
140 depends on SND_CS46XX && EXPERIMENTAL
142 Say Y here to use a new DSP image for SPDIF and dual codecs.
144 This works better than the old code, so say Y.
147 tristate "Cirrus Logic (Sound Fusion) CS4281"
151 select SND_AC97_CODEC
153 Say Y here to include support for Cirrus Logic CS4281 chips.
155 To compile this driver as a module, choose M here: the module
156 will be called snd-cs4281.
159 tristate "Emu10k1 (SB Live!, Audigy, E-mu APS)"
163 select SND_AC97_CODEC
165 Say Y to include support for Sound Blaster PCI 512, Live!,
166 Audigy and E-mu APS (partially supported) soundcards.
168 The confusing multitude of mixer controls is documented in
169 <file:Documentation/sound/alsa/SB-Live-mixer.txt> and
170 <file:Documentation/sound/alsa/Audigy-mixer.txt>.
172 To compile this driver as a module, choose M here: the module
173 will be called snd-emu10k1.
176 tristate "Emu10k1X (Dell OEM Version)"
178 select SND_AC97_CODEC
181 Say Y here to include support for the Dell OEM version of the
184 To compile this driver as a module, choose M here: the module
185 will be called snd-emu10k1x.
188 tristate "SB Audigy LS / Live 24bit"
190 select SND_AC97_CODEC
192 Say Y here to include support for the Sound Blaster Audigy LS
195 To compile this driver as a module, choose M here: the module
196 will be called snd-ca0106.
199 tristate "Korg 1212 IO"
203 Say Y here to include support for Korg 1212IO soundcards.
205 To compile this driver as a module, choose M here: the module
206 will be called snd-korg1212.
209 tristate "Digigram miXart"
214 If you want to use Digigram miXart soundcards, say Y here and
215 read <file:Documentation/sound/alsa/MIXART.txt>.
217 To compile this driver as a module, choose M here: the module
218 will be called snd-mixart.
221 tristate "NeoMagic NM256AV/ZX"
223 select SND_AC97_CODEC
225 Say Y here to include support for NeoMagic NM256AV/ZX chips.
227 To compile this driver as a module, choose M here: the module
228 will be called snd-nm256.
231 tristate "RME Digi32, 32/8, 32 PRO"
235 Say Y to include support for RME Digi32, Digi32 PRO and
236 Digi32/8 (Sek'd Prodif32, Prodif96 and Prodif Gold) audio
239 To compile this driver as a module, choose M here: the module
240 will be called snd-rme32.
243 tristate "RME Digi96, 96/8, 96/8 PRO"
247 Say Y here to include support for RME Digi96, Digi96/8 and
248 Digi96/8 PRO/PAD/PST soundcards.
250 To compile this driver as a module, choose M here: the module
251 will be called snd-rme96.
254 tristate "RME Digi9652 (Hammerfall)"
258 Say Y here to include support for RME Hammerfall (RME
259 Digi9652/Digi9636) soundcards.
261 To compile this driver as a module, choose M here: the module
262 will be called snd-rme9652.
265 tristate "RME Hammerfall DSP Audio"
271 Say Y here to include support for RME Hammerfall DSP Audio
274 To compile this driver as a module, choose M here: the module
275 will be called snd-hdsp.
278 tristate "RME Hammerfall DSP MADI"
284 Say Y here to include support for RME Hammerfall DSP MADI
287 To compile this driver as a module, choose M here: the module
288 will be called snd-hdspm.
291 tristate "Trident 4D-Wave DX/NX; SiS 7018"
293 select SND_MPU401_UART
294 select SND_AC97_CODEC
296 Say Y here to include support for soundcards based on Trident
297 4D-Wave DX/NX or SiS 7018 chips.
299 To compile this driver as a module, choose M here: the module
300 will be called snd-trident.
303 tristate "Yamaha YMF724/740/744/754"
306 select SND_MPU401_UART
307 select SND_AC97_CODEC
309 Say Y here to include support for Yamaha PCI audio chips -
310 YMF724, YMF724F, YMF740, YMF740C, YMF744, YMF754.
312 To compile this driver as a module, choose M here: the module
313 will be called snd-ymfpci.
316 tristate "Avance Logic ALS4000"
319 select SND_MPU401_UART
322 Say Y here to include support for soundcards based on Avance Logic
325 To compile this driver as a module, choose M here: the module
326 will be called snd-als4000.
329 tristate "C-Media 8738, 8338"
332 select SND_MPU401_UART
335 If you want to use soundcards based on C-Media CMI8338 or CMI8738
336 chips, say Y here and read
337 <file:Documentation/sound/alsa/CMIPCI.txt>.
339 To compile this driver as a module, choose M here: the module
340 will be called snd-cmipci.
343 tristate "(Creative) Ensoniq AudioPCI 1370"
348 Say Y here to include support for Ensoniq AudioPCI ES1370 chips.
350 To compile this driver as a module, choose M here: the module
351 will be called snd-ens1370.
354 tristate "(Creative) Ensoniq AudioPCI 1371/1373"
357 select SND_AC97_CODEC
359 Say Y here to include support for Ensoniq AudioPCI ES1371 chips and
360 Sound Blaster PCI 64 or 128 soundcards.
362 To compile this driver as a module, choose M here: the module
363 will be called snd-ens1371.
366 tristate "ESS ES1938/1946/1969 (Solo-1)"
369 select SND_MPU401_UART
370 select SND_AC97_CODEC
372 Say Y here to include support for soundcards based on ESS Solo-1
373 (ES1938, ES1946, ES1969) chips.
375 To compile this driver as a module, choose M here: the module
376 will be called snd-es1938.
379 tristate "ESS ES1968/1978 (Maestro-1/2/2E)"
381 select SND_MPU401_UART
382 select SND_AC97_CODEC
384 Say Y here to include support for soundcards based on ESS Maestro
387 To compile this driver as a module, choose M here: the module
388 will be called snd-es1968.
391 tristate "ESS Allegro/Maestro3"
393 select SND_AC97_CODEC
395 Say Y here to include support for soundcards based on ESS Maestro 3
398 To compile this driver as a module, choose M here: the module
399 will be called snd-maestro3.
402 tristate "ForteMedia FM801"
405 select SND_MPU401_UART
406 select SND_AC97_CODEC
408 Say Y here to include support for soundcards based on the ForteMedia
411 To compile this driver as a module, choose M here: the module
412 will be called snd-fm801.
414 config SND_FM801_TEA575X
415 tristate "ForteMedia FM801 + TEA5757 tuner"
419 Say Y here to include support for soundcards based on the ForteMedia
420 FM801 chip with a TEA5757 tuner connected to GPIO1-3 pins (Media
423 To compile this driver as a module, choose M here: the module
424 will be called snd-fm801-tea575x.
427 tristate "ICEnsemble ICE1712 (Envy24)"
429 select SND_MPU401_UART
430 select SND_AC97_CODEC
432 Say Y here to include support for soundcards based on the
433 ICE1712 (Envy24) chip.
435 Currently supported hardware is: M-Audio Delta 1010(LT),
436 DiO 2496, 66, 44, 410, Audiophile 24/96; Digigram VX442;
437 TerraTec EWX 24/96, EWS 88MT, 88D, DMX 6Fire, Phase 88;
438 Hoontech SoundTrack DSP 24/Value/Media7.1; Event EZ8.
440 To compile this driver as a module, choose M here: the module
441 will be called snd-ice1712.
444 tristate "ICE/VT1724/1720 (Envy24HT/PT)"
446 select SND_MPU401_UART
447 select SND_AC97_CODEC
449 Say Y here to include support for soundcards based on
450 ICE/VT1724/1720 (Envy24HT/PT) chips.
452 Currently supported hardware is: AMP AUDIO2000; M-Audio
453 Revolution 7.1; TerraTec Aureon 5.1 Sky, 7.1 Space/Universe;
454 AudioTrak Prodigy 7.1; Pontis MS300; Albatron K8X800 Pro II;
455 Chaintech ZNF3-150/250.
457 To compile this driver as a module, choose M here: the module
458 will be called snd-ice1724.
461 tristate "Intel/SiS/nVidia/AMD/ALi AC97 Controller"
463 select SND_AC97_CODEC
465 Say Y here to include support for the integrated AC97 sound
466 device on motherboards with Intel/SiS/nVidia/AMD chipsets, or
467 ALi chipsets using the M5455 Audio Controller. (There is a
468 separate driver for ALi M5451 Audio Controllers.)
470 To compile this driver as a module, choose M here: the module
471 will be called snd-intel8x0.
474 tristate "Intel/SiS/nVidia/AMD MC97 Modem (EXPERIMENTAL)"
475 depends on SND && EXPERIMENTAL
476 select SND_AC97_CODEC
478 Say Y here to include support for the integrated MC97 modem on
479 motherboards with Intel/SiS/nVidia/AMD chipsets.
481 To compile this driver as a module, choose M here: the module
482 will be called snd-intel8x0m.
484 config SND_SONICVIBES
485 tristate "S3 SonicVibes"
488 select SND_MPU401_UART
489 select SND_AC97_CODEC
491 Say Y here to include support for soundcards based on the S3
494 To compile this driver as a module, choose M here: the module
495 will be called snd-sonicvibes.
498 tristate "VIA 82C686A/B, 8233/8235 AC97 Controller"
500 select SND_MPU401_UART
501 select SND_AC97_CODEC
503 Say Y here to include support for the integrated AC97 sound
504 device on motherboards with VIA chipsets.
506 To compile this driver as a module, choose M here: the module
507 will be called snd-via82xx.
509 config SND_VIA82XX_MODEM
510 tristate "VIA 82C686A/B, 8233 based Modems"
512 select SND_AC97_CODEC
514 Say Y here to include support for the integrated MC97 modem on
515 motherboards with VIA chipsets.
517 To compile this driver as a module, choose M here: the module
518 will be called snd-via82xx-modem.
521 tristate "Digigram VX222"
525 Say Y here to include support for Digigram VX222 soundcards.
527 To compile this driver as a module, choose M here: the module
528 will be called snd-vx222.
531 tristate "Intel HD Audio"
535 Say Y here to include support for Intel "High Definition
536 Audio" (Azalia) motherboard devices.
538 To compile this driver as a module, choose M here: the module
539 will be called snd-hda-intel.